Python中的日志模块
日志的作用
- 日记
- 程序行为
- 重要信息记录
日志的等级
debug
info
warning
error
critical
logging模块的使用
logging.basicConfig
参数名 | 作用 | 举例 |
---|---|---|
level |
日志输出等级 | level = logging.DEBUG |
format |
日志输出格式 | |
filename |
存储位置 | filename = 'd://back.log' |
filemode |
输入模式 | filemode = "w" |
format具体格式
格式符 | 含义 |
---|---|
%(levelname)s |
日志级别名称 |
%(pathname)s |
执行程序的路径 |
%(filename)s |
执行程序名 |
%(lineno)d |
日志的当前行号 |
%(asctime)s |
打印日志的时间 |
%(message)s |
日志信息 |
format = '%(asctime)s %(filename)s[line:%(lineno)d] %(levelname)s %(message)s'
- (常用的格式)
代码
本博客所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明来自 ZkeqのCoding日志!
评论